On February 22, 2020, the comic book "Today's Miss Cat Village" created by cartoonist Riko Hoshiyu announced that it would be filmed into a live-action TV series, and the powerful actor Yutaka Matsushige, who played the male protagonist in "The Solitary Gourmet", will play the "cat nanny". Today (March 30), the official released the latest trailer and some stills, let's enjoy them together.

The latest trailer for "Today's Miss Cat Village":

"Today's Miss Catmura" tells the story of a very enthusiastic cat who seems weak but is strong at heart. In order to go abroad to see the little master who saved his life, Catmura has been working part-time to earn money to learn English. It is reported that this Japanese drama will be broadcast on Tokyo TV every Wednesday in the form of a 2-minute 30-second mini-series starting from April 8, with a total of 24 episodes.
